OpenVPN Client Config inkl. Key?

arberex99

Lieutenant
Registriert
Aug. 2020
Beiträge
618
Hallo,

ich das ist meine OpenVPN Server Config:

1644587601440.png

1644587606852.png


Jetzt würde ich gerne eine client.ovpn Config File erstellen, allerdings scheint das nicht zu passen. Wisst ihr, wie die richtige Schreibweise ist und wie der <tag> für static-key richtig lautet?

Code:
client
proto udp
remote xxx.yyy.com
port 1194
dev tun

<key>
-----BEGIN OpenVPN Static key V1-----
11111111111111111111111111111111
22222222222222222222222222222222
33333333333333333333333333333333
-----END OpenVPN Static key V1-----
</key>
 
Schau mal hier. Da wird gezeigt wie du das Zertifikat in der .ovpn embedden kannst.
 
madmax2010 schrieb:
pack den key in eine datei und machst das dann so:
Danke, ist bekannt, aber ich brauche es halt unbedingt in der gleichen Datei.

Raijin schrieb:
Schau mal hier. Da wird gezeigt wie du das Zertifikat in der .ovpn embedden kannst.
Ein Zertifikat gibt es in meinem Fall ja gar nicht, oder?

TheCadillacMan schrieb:
Für einen Static Key muss secret statt key verwendet werden.
Also einfach so?

Code:
client
proto udp
remote xxx.yyy.com
port 1194
dev tun

<secret>
-----BEGIN OpenVPN Static key V1-----
11111111111111111111111111111111
22222222222222222222222222222222
33333333333333333333333333333333
-----END OpenVPN Static key V1-----
</secret>

In der iPhone App OpenVPN krieg ich damit leider immer diesen Fehler. Aber welches Zertifikat soll ich definieren, wenn gar keines in Verwendung ist??

1644588852220.png
 
Danke, aber wo muss ich das CA Cert am Server in der GUI eintragen?
Das Feld gibt es nur, wenn ich von Static-Key auf TLS umstelle. TLS und multiple Clients brauch ich nicht, deshalb würd ich es einfach gern nur mit Static-Key machen.
 
Ich habe absolut keine Ahnung von der GUI und weiss auch nicht ob die alleine ausreicht.
Wie hast du denn die keys erstellt?
 
arberex99 schrieb:
ich konnte mich mit einem anderen VPN Client (selbe GUI) schon erfolgreich verbinden.
Dann schau doch mal in die resultierende Config, die dieser Client erzeugt hat. Das ist doch die beste Anlaufstelle für eine funktionierende Konfiguration.
 
  • Gefällt mir
Reaktionen: Raijin und madmax2010
riversource schrieb:
Dann schau doch mal in die resultierende Config, die dieser Client erzeugt hat. Das ist doch die beste Anlaufstelle für eine funktionierende Konfiguration.
Wollte ich machen, aber ich finde diese leider nicht. Die server.ovpn wird erzeugt, aber client leider nicht. Hätte komplett / nach ovpn durchsuchen lassen, aber leider nur server.ovpn gefunden.
 
Jetzt hast du mich verwirrt.

arberex99 schrieb:
Also die GUI reicht aus und ich konnte mich mit einem anderen VPN Client (selbe GUI) schon erfolgreich verbinden.
Hier steht eindeutig "anderer VPN Client".

arberex99 schrieb:
Die server.ovpn wird erzeugt, aber client leider nicht.
Ja, wie jetzt? Der Server hat damit doch gar nichts zu tun. Server und Client waren doch unterschiedliche Geräte.

Was genau hast du unternommen? Welcher Client auf welchem System, und welche GUI?

Generell: OpenVPN Configs müssen nicht .ovpn heißen. Aber je nach Betriebssystem liegen sie in vorgegebenen Ordnern, z.B. "/etc/openvpn" oder c":\Benutzer\user\OpenVPN\config".
 
  • Gefällt mir
Reaktionen: madmax2010
Server = Router 1
Client = Router 2

Beide haben das gleiche Tomato Image drauf. Ist es jetzt verständlich?
 
Aber du hast die beiden erfolgreich miteinander verbunden? Dann wird sich deine funktionierende Client Konfiguration vermutlich in der server.ovpn verstecken.
 
Nein, da war sie leider nicht drin. Hätte ich auch geschaut.
Ergänzung ()

Ich hab die Config für den Client jetzt doch gefunden. Hilft mir aber leider nicht, da der Key auch in einem extra File ist und das unterstützt die OpenVPN App am iPhone nicht.
 
Zuletzt bearbeitet:
Bin unterwegs..

Google mal nach openvpn config in line p12

Oder so
Oder Google nach iPhone openvpn config example
 
Zurück
Oben